Passengers using a rail link to get to or from Ottawa’s international airport,
if such a link is ever built, would likely have to change trains at South Keys
station, residents learned this week at an open house showcasing the ambitious
plan to expand O-Train service. The city’s preferred option for extending the
north-south Trillium line from Greenboro station to Riverside South — for which
it is currently conducting an environmental assessment — includes a spur to the
Macdonald-Cartier International Airport and the EY Centre. via
